Job Description

As Senior Scientist I or II in AbbVie Drug Delivery Sciences, you will work as a key part of a talented, multidisciplinary, and cross-functional team to build cutting-edge capabilities for the delivery of biologics and small molecules and advance new products through early R&D.  We are seeking a highly motivated PhD Chemical Engineer specializing in the modeling and simulation of drug release kinetics in advanced drug delivery systems. The successful candidate will apply first-principles understanding to design, optimize, and analyze drug delivery platforms, utilizing quantitative models to predict and control drug release profiles.

Responsibilities:

  • Develop and apply mechanistic models for drug release kinetics from various sustained drug delivery platforms (e.g., in situ forming depots, implants, hydrogels, etc.,).
  • Employ first-principles approaches (e.g., diffusion, convection, chemical reaction theories) to solve complex transport problems relevant to drug delivery formulations.
  • Design, execute, and analyze computational simulations using tools such as COMSOL Multiphysics or similar platforms.
  • Collaborate with formulation and material scientists, and pharmacologists, to translate modeling results into experimental design and product development.
  • Interpret experimental release data and integrate findings into enhanced models for predictive accuracy.
  • Communicate findings through technical reports, publications, and presentations

Qualifications

  • PhD in Chemical Engineering
  • Senior Scientist I: PhD with 0 - 4 years of relevant experience (industry, post-docs, or academia).
  • Senior Scientist II: PhD with 4+ years of relevant industry experience.
  • Strong foundation in mass transport phenomena (diffusion, dissolution, convection, degradation).
  • Demonstrated expertise in mathematical modeling and simulation of controlled release mechanisms.
  • Proficiency in relevant modeling and simulation software (COMSOL Multiphysics, Monte Carlo methods or equivalent)
  • Excellent problem-solving, quantitative, and communication skills.
  • Ability to work collaboratively in a multidisciplinary environment.
  • Prior experience with drug delivery system design and evaluation is preferred.
